If you are getting it with an AP for $75 you need to spend $375 to break even. If you are getting it with DVC for $100, you need to spend $500 to break even.

Okay, I just called the Tables in Wonderland phone number. The CM when I made the ADR for the Spirit of Aloha show was "WRONG"! lol! He said I should get the discount when I get there. That's not correct. When you call Disney to make your ADR for a dinner show YOU NEED TO GIVE THEM YOUR TIW NUMBER at that point, NOT WHEN YOU GET THERE, lol! I just want everyone to be clear that's why I capped the previous sentence, lol!

They had to rebook me using the TIW number first. They put the discounted amount on my VISA, then THEY CANCELLED my old reservation. This took about 25 minutes, but at least it is done.

Estimate how much you will be spending on food for this trip. As long as you will be spending at least $375, then you will hit your break even point on the cost of getting the TIW. Remember to only include your TS ADRs. My guess would be with the 4 ADRs you have listed, is that you would definitely hit the break even point and most likely surpass it (especially when you include alcohol). For example, my DH and I ate at Jiko last May and our total bill for that meal alone, including a bottle of wine, was $197.
